Mashpee Neck, MA vs North Seekonk, MA
There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. North Seekonk is 15.7% cheaper than Mashpee Neck. With a cost index of 108 vs 125,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from North Seekonk to Mashpee Neck should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.
When it comes to buying, median home values in Mashpee Neck are $578,400 compared to $417,300 in North Seekonk, a 39% gap.
Median household income in Mashpee Neck is $131,250 compared to $110,541 in North Seekonk (+18.7%). While Mashpee Neck is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income.
Climate-wise, both cities share similar average temperatures (51.5°F vs 52.1°F). North Seekonk receives more rainfall at 47.5" per year compared to 44.7" in Mashpee Neck.
